X600.5 Owners Manual
The Pass Laboratories X600.5 stereo amplifier embodies the de-
sign technology and refinements of the “X” series amplifiers includ-
ing extensions of the patented Supersymmetry™ circuit. Additionally
selected refinements of the XA series amplifiers have been incorpo-
rated into the X600.5 to significantly improve this products sonic
performance in comparison to it’s immediate predecessor, the Pass
Laboratories™ X600.
The Supersymmetry™ circuit topology was granted a U.S. patent in
1994, and was the result of 19 years of effort by legendary analog
designer and company founder Nelson Pass. The amplifier uses
highly matched components in a classically simple single ended Class
A circuit. The amplifier contains only two simple stages: the first is a
balanced Class A gain stage. Its output drives a bank of high power
devices operated as followers.
These are inherently low distortion types of circuits, but their perfor-
mance is significantly improved when operated as balanced devices.
Distortion and noise identical to both halves of a balanced circuit can
be made to disappear at the output, and in a well-matched symmetric
circuit, most of the distortion and noise is identical.
Pass Laboratories Supersymmetry™ enhances this effect by provid-
ing a connection between the two halves of the balanced circuit that
further perfects the match of common mode artifacts. Any distor-
tion and noise not already identical to the two halves is made more
identical by a factor of about 10. The result of this perfected match
is improved noise cancellation at the output of the amplifier. From a
listeners standpoint this results in a more accurate presentation of the
soundstage and better resolution of low level detail.
Unlike feedback techniques where the goal is to correct for the distor-
tion by feeding a gain stage an inversely distorted signal, Supersymme-
try™ seeks merely to create perfect matching between the two halves
of an otherwise well matched circuit.
Matched balanced power circuitry typically sees a distortion and noise
reduction of about 90% (20 dB) through a balanced connection
without any additional effort. The Supersymmetry™ circuit delivers
another 90% reduction, so that the X series has about 1/100 of the
distortion of a conventionally simple and otherwise identical ampli-
fier. Distortion and noise can still be seen at the output of one half of
the circuit, but since it is virtually identical on the other half, these un-
desirable artifacts largely go away at the speaker terminals. This gives
good measured performance, and because a simple circuit produces it,
also sounds quiet excellent.
